DXR-200N Portable Dental X Ray Machine for Dental Clinic & Mobile Dentistry
PRODUCT DESCRIPTION
This portable dental X-ray machine is designed for efficient and precise intraoral imaging in modern dental practices. With a powerful 210W output and high-frequency technology, it delivers clear, stable images to support accurate diagnosis.
Featuring a smart touch screen for easy operation and a lightweight 1.7KG handheld design, it allows for flexible, one-handed use in clinics or mobile settings. The built-in high-capacity battery supports up to 300 exposures on a single charge, ensuring reliable performance throughout the day.
Equipped with a 4-layer radiation shielding system, this device enhances safety for both patients and operators. Compact, user-friendly, and dependable, it is an ideal solution for dental professionals seeking convenience, mobility, and imaging precision.
